免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

webapp 源码

Web App,又称为 Web 应用程序,是一种使用 Web 技术进行开发的应用程序。它不需要像传统应用程序那样安装在本地设备上,而是通过浏览器访问,具有跨平台、易于维护、更新方便等特点。下面将介绍 Web App 的原理和源码实现。

Web App 的原理

Web App 的核心技术是 HTML、CSS 和 JavaScript,这三种技术构成了 Web App 的前端部分。HTML 负责页面结构的定义,CSS 负责页面样式的定义,JavaScript 负责页面行为的定义。同时,Web App 还需要后端技术来支持,常见的后端技术包括 PHP、Java、Python 等。

Web App 的实现过程主要分为以下几个步骤:

1.页面设计:根据业务需求设计页面结构和样式。

2.编写 HTML 代码:根据页面设计编写 HTML 代码,定义页面结构。

3.编写 CSS 代码:根据页面设计编写 CSS 代码,定义页面样式。

4.编写 JavaScript 代码:根据业务需求编写 JavaScript 代码,实现页面行为。

5.后端支持:根据业务需求选择合适的后端技术,实现后端逻辑。

6.测试和部署:对 Web App 进行测试,确保其能够正常运行。然后将其部署到服务器上,供用户访问。

Web App 的源码实现

下面以一个简单的 Web App 为例,介绍其源码实现。

HTML 代码:

```

Web App

Welcome to Web App

This is a simple Web App.

```

CSS 代码:

```

.container {

text-align: center;

margin-top: 100px;

}

h1 {

font-size: 36px;

color: #333;

}

p {

font-size: 24px;

color: #666;

}

button {

font-size: 20px;

color: #fff;

background-color: #0099ff;

border: none;

border-radius: 5px;

padding: 10px 20px;

margin-top: 20px;

cursor: pointer;

}

```

JavaScript 代码:

```

var btn = document.getElementById('btn');

btn.addEventListener('click', function() {

alert('Hello, Web App!');

});

```

上述代码实现了一个简单的 Web App,包含一个欢迎页面和一个点击按钮。当用户点击按钮时,会弹出一个提示框,显示“Hello, Web App!”。

总结

Web App 是一种使用 Web 技术进行开发的应用程序,具有跨平台、易于维护、更新方便等特点。其实现过程主要包括页面设计、HTML、CSS 和 JavaScript 代码编写、后端支持、测试和部署等步骤。开发者需要掌握 HTML、CSS 和 JavaScript 的基本知识,并选择合适的后端技术来支持 Web App 的实现。


相关知识:
android nfc开发
近年来,随着智能手机的普及,NFC(Near Field Communication,近场通信)技术也逐渐成为了移动设备的标配之一。NFC技术可以实现设备之间的无线通信,具有简单、快捷、安全等优点,被广泛应用于移动支付、门禁控制、智能家居等领域。本文将介绍
2023-04-06
flutter app 框架
Flutter是由Google开发的一套跨平台的移动应用开发框架,它可以让开发者使用一套代码同时开发iOS和Android应用,甚至还可以开发桌面端和Web应用。Flutter采用了Dart语言作为开发语言,Dart是一门由Google开发的新型编程语言,
2023-04-06
h5打包应用
H5打包应用是将基于HTML5技术的Web应用程序打包成原生应用程序的过程。这种技术可以将Web应用程序转化为可在移动设备上运行的本地应用程序,从而提供更好的用户体验和更高的性能。下面将介绍H5打包应用的原理和详细过程。一、H5打包应用的原理H5打包应用的
2023-04-06
vue 写 app
Vue 是一款流行的前端框架,可以用于构建 Web 应用程序。但是,Vue 也可以用于构建移动应用程序,即 Vue Native。Vue Native 是一个基于 Vue.js 的移动应用程序框架,它可以让开发人员使用 Vue.js 构建原生移动应用程序。
2023-04-06
app打包软件之后加cdkey
在软件开发领域中,打包是一个非常重要的环节。打包是将程序代码、资源文件、库文件等打包成一个可执行文件或者安装包的过程。在打包的过程中,可以加入CDKey,使得软件在安装时需要输入CDKey才能继续安装。这种做法可以有效地防止盗版和非法复制。CDKey是一组
2023-04-06
网上超火的转app
随着智能手机的普及和互联网的发展,移动应用成为人们日常生活中不可或缺的一部分。但是,随着应用数量的增加,用户下载和使用应用的难度也随之增加。为了解决这一问题,转app应运而生。转app是一种将多个应用合并为一个应用的技术。它能够将多个应用程序的功能整合到一
2023-04-06
快乐购 html网页制作
快乐购是一家在线购物网站,为了提高用户体验和销售效果,他们决定重新设计他们的网站。在设计新网站时,他们需要更好地了解HTML网页制作的原理和过程。本文将详细介绍HTML网页制作的原理和过程,以帮助快乐购更好地制作他们的新网站。HTML是超文本标记语言的缩写
2023-04-06
discuz社区app
Discuz是一款开源的PHP论坛程序,广泛应用于各种类型的社区网站,包括门户网站、博客、论坛、问答社区等等。随着移动互联网的发展,越来越多的用户开始使用手机来访问社区网站,因此Discuz社区也推出了Discuz社区APP,以满足用户在移动端的需求。Di
2023-04-06
原生开发 混合开发 h5开发
随着智能手机的普及,移动应用开发成为了互联网领域中的热门话题。开发者们也在不断探索和尝试不同的开发方式,以满足不同需求和场景的应用开发。在移动应用开发中,原生开发、混合开发和H5开发是三种常见的开发方式。本文将介绍这三种开发方式的原理和详细内容。1. 原生
2023-04-06
vue 移动端框架示例
Vue 移动端框架是一种基于 Vue.js 的移动端 UI 组件库,它为开发者提供了一套高质量、易用、高性能的组件库,方便开发者快速构建移动端应用程序。Vue 移动端框架的设计理念是:简单、易用、高效、灵活。下面我们将介绍 Vue 移动端框架的原理和详细介
2023-04-06
演示软件制作app
随着移动互联网的快速发展,越来越多的企业和个人开始意识到移动应用程序的重要性。而演示软件也成为了越来越多人在移动应用市场中的选择。那么,如何制作一款演示软件app呢?下面就给大家介绍一下演示软件app的制作原理和详细步骤。一、演示软件制作原理演示软件app
2023-04-06
h5与ios交互
H5与iOS交互是指在iOS系统中使用H5技术进行开发,并且在H5页面中能够调用iOS系统的原生功能。这样的交互方式可以让开发者使用H5技术快速开发iOS应用,同时也能够利用iOS系统原生功能提升应用的用户体验。H5与iOS交互的原理主要是通过JavaSc
2023-04-06
©2015-2021 成都七扇门科技有限公司 yimenapp.cn  川公网安备 51019002001185号 蜀ICP备17005078号